What is a Crossword Clue?

According to The New York Times, a crossword clue is “a hint that the solver must decipher to find the answer that is then entered into the puzzle grid.” Depending on the puzzle type, clues can range from synonyms to definitions, from puns to wordplay and from general knowledge to fill-in-the-blanks. The possibilities are endless.

What is a Crossword Answer?

When you solve for a clue, the resulting word or phrase is the answer, sometimes called a “fill”. Fills can range from one word to multiple words. When you have solved for all clues in a puzzle, all of the answers contribute to a completed puzzle.

Learn Crosswordese 

Crosswordese is a group of words used by puzzle constructors to add more vowels to the board. These range from abbreviations to fictional cartoon characters, or from brand names to latin phrases. As you continue through your solving journey, you’ll begin to familiarize yourself with some of the most common Crosswordese. Here are some of our favorites: 

SMEE (Mr. Smee is a fictional character who serves as Captain Hook's boatswain or a small compact diving duck)
